Question 23

Light travels in straight lines. In which of the following is this principle manifested? I. Pinhole camera II Formation of shadows III. Diffraction of light IV. Occurrence of eclipse

  • A.I and III only
  • B.II and III only
  • C.I, II and III only
  • D.I, II and IV only
  • E.I, II, III and IV
